An opportunity to work at this happy and successful infant and nursery school. Applications are invited from candidates with the experience and aptitude to be able to be an adaptable business manager to join our school and play a key role in its future. You will work closely with stakeholders to continue to develop the school and share our commitment to the learning, progress and well-being of all our children and staff.

The successful candidate will be an enthusiastic, self-motivated and resourceful professional. They will take the strategic lead in planning, development and monitoring of finance, personnel and premises related issues. They will be able to communicate effectively at all levels and will also lead and manage our office and support teams.

We invite people from a range of professional backgrounds with strong finance / accounting skills. Applications with a qualification in School Business Management or experience in school would be particularly welcome.

The structure of the school office will be:

• School Business Manager – (37 hours) 

• Clerical Assistant/Office Administrator – (37 hours) 

• Senior midday providing school meal information for the school kitchen – (5 hours) 

The School Business Manager will work 41 weeks per year – term time plus two weeks. It is anticipated the additional week will normally be worked at the end of the summer holidays, in preparation for the new school year, though 1 or 2 days may alternatively be worked at other times, in agreement with the head teacher, if this is more useful. Working hours will be 8.00am to 4pm Monday to Thursday during term time, Friday 8.00am-3.30pm with half an hour unpaid lunch.
